Hi Guys
Having an odd problem Ubuntu Server. I can't get it to execute any
executable files I add to the system. Everything else that's already
there works.
Whenever I try to execute one of my file I get the following...
$:/home/EagleTrack$ ./eddx
-bash: ./eddx: No such file or directory
All the right flags are set...
$:/home/EagleTrack$ ls -l
total 6528
-rwxr-xr-x 1 recosys recosys 1739 2009-11-25 01:58 eagletrack
-rwxr-xr-x 1 recosys recosys 2421214 2009-11-25 14:02 eddx
drwxr-xr-x 2 recosys recosys 4096 2009-11-25 01:59 ini
drwxr-xr-x 2 recosys recosys 4096 2009-11-25 01:57 log
-rwxr-xr-x 1 recosys recosys 2534073 2009-11-25 02:00
minetagreceiverport
-rwxr-xr-x 1 recosys recosys 1709372 2009-11-25 02:01 watchdog
